ホームページ >よくある問題 >ビッグデータを学ぶために必要な基礎とは

ビッグデータを学ぶために必要な基礎とは

青灯夜游
青灯夜游オリジナル
2019-05-09 11:43:4422523ブラウズ

企業社会におけるビッグデータテクノロジーの実践が本格化するにつれ、企業はビッグデータチームの結成がますます緊急になっており、ビッグデータに関連するハイエンド人材の需要もますます高まっています。 。ただし、データ エンジニアは短期間で鍛えられるものではないため、ビッグデータを学ぶ前に、ある程度の基礎が必要です。

ビッグデータを学ぶために必要な基礎とは

#1. ビッグ データの理論を理解する

ビッグ データを学ぶには、少なくともビッグデータがどのようなものかを知っておく必要があります。データは一般的にどのような分野で使用されますか?ビッグデータについての一般的な理解がなければ、ビッグデータに興味があるかどうかを知ることができません。ビッグデータについて何も知らずに学習を始めると、実際にはビッグデータが好きではないことがわかる可能性があり、時間とエネルギーの無駄です。 . 、おそらくお金の無駄です。したがって、ビッグデータを学びたい場合は、まずビッグデータについて一般的に理解する必要があります。

2、java

ビッグ データ フレームワークの 90% は Java で書かれています。例:

## ●MongoDB - 最も人気のある、クロスプラットフォームのドキュメント指向データベース。

## ● Hadoop - 非常に大規模なデータ セットの分散ストレージと分散処理のために Java で書かれたオープン ソース ソフトウェア フレームワーク。

## Spark - Apache Software Foundation で最も活発なプロジェクトは、オープンソースのクラスター コンピューティング フレームワークです。

Hbase - オープン ソースの非リレーショナル分散データベース。Google の BigTable をモデルとしており、Java で書かれ、HDFS 上で実行されます。

Java の設計とプログラミングの考え方、Java オブジェクト指向、Java の上級、Web フロントエンド開発、HTML の基礎、CSS3、JS スクリプト プログラミング、JavaEE プログラム開発、JavaWeb バックエンド開発を理解する必要があります。

3. MySQL (マスターする必要があります)

4. Linux

ビッグ データ フレームワークがインストールされ、動作します。 Linux システム

5、Hadoop、Scala、HBase、Hive、Spark

学習プロセスでは、時間とエネルギーを投資し、興味を持って学習を推進します。実践的なコーディングは必須です。あなたが見ているのは他の人のコードであり、あなたが書いているのはあなた自身のものです。

以上がビッグデータを学ぶために必要な基礎とはの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。